Kevin Bacon Signs New Movie

Golden Globe winner and Emmy nominated Kevin Bacon has recently joined the cast of the untitled Blumhouse horror movie.

Bacon is also set to executive produce the movie along with Scott Turner Schofield.

The movie is directed and written by the three-time Oscar-nominated writer John Logan and marks his directorial debut.

Blumhouse founder Jason Blum will also produce the movie alongside Michael Aguilar.

The currently untitled project is currently in development. A release window for it is currently unknown.

Bacon recently starred in season 2 of Showtime’s hit series "City on a Hill", which was renewed for a third season.

He also appeared in and co-produced David Koepp’s "You Should Have Left".

The Footloose and J.F.K. star is set to join his wife Kyra Sedgwick’s second feature directorial "Space Oddity".

He can next be seen in movies "One Way" and "The Toxic Avenger".
